Blackpool Airport hopes to regain London link
13.04.08
A Blackpool Airport official has said that the airport is doing all they can to reinstate a London link.
Ryanair operated a daily service to Stansted from the airport until May last year, but pulled out citing a lack of passengers. Since then local people have had to travel to Manchester to fly to London, or go by train or road.
Sue Kendrick, communications manager for Blackpool Airport, said: ‘We are trying to establish a new link. One of the key points we are making to airlines is that there is no direct transport link to London from the area. When you consider the Ryanair service was used by over 200,000 people, you realise just why we need such a link.’
